Today we hit the midpoint of The Witcher Season 3 with Episode 4 where Geralt is now back by Ciri's side escorting her to Aretuza himself.
Follow along as we see Jasper's nemesis for the first time, a battle with an aeschna, Yennefer convincing Vizimir to send Phillipa and Dijkstra to the conclave following his wife's assassination, a dangerous illusion, and compiling of evidence indicating a traitor in the Brotherhood.
With Chase & Josh summarizing the episode, reviewing the highs and lows, drawing comparisons from earlier seasons, and debating viewpoints, be sure to stick around.
